In finance, an exchange rate also known as a foreign exchange rate, forex rate, ER, FX rate or Agio between two currencies is the rate at which one currency will be exchanged for another. It is also regarded as the value of one countrys currency in relation to another currency. For example, an interbank exchange rate of 1. The real exchange rate RER is the purchasing power of a currency relative to another at current exchange rates and prices. It is the ratio of the number of units of a given countrys currency necessary to buy a market basket of goods in the other country, after acquiring the other countrys currency in the foreign exchange market, to the number of units of the given countrys currency that would be necessary to buy that market basket directly in the given country. There are various ways to measure RER. Thus the real exchange rate is the exchange rate times the relative prices of a market basket of goods in the two countries. For example, the purchasing power of the US dollar relative to that of the euro is the dollar price of a euro dollars per euro times the euro price of one unit of the market basket eurosgoods unit divided by the dollar price of the market basket dollars per goods unit, and hence is dimensionless. This is the exchange rate expressed as dollars per euro times the relative price of the two currencies in terms of their ability to purchase units of the market basket euros per goods unit divided by dollars per goods unit. If all goods were freely tradable, and foreign and domestic residents purchased identical baskets of goods, purchasing power parity PPP would hold for the exchange rate and GDP deflators price levels of the two countries, and the real exchange rate would always equal 1. This paper deals with application of quantitative soft computing prediction models into financial area as reliable and accurate prediction models can be very helpful in management decision making process. The authors suggest a new hybrid neural network which is a combination of the standard RBF neural network, a genetic algorithm, and a moving average. The moving average is supposed to enhance the outputs of the network using the error part of the original neural network. Authors test the suggested model on high frequency time series data of USDCAD and examine the ability to forecast exchange rate values for the horizon of one day. To determine the forecasting efficiency, they perform a comparative statistical out of sample analysis of the tested model with autoregressive models and the standard neural network. They also incorporate genetic algorithm as an optimizing technique for adapting parameters of ANN which is then compared with standard backpropagation and backpropagation combined with K means clustering algorithm. Finally, the authors find out that their suggested hybrid neural network is able to produce more accurate forecasts than the standard models and can be helpful in eliminating the risk of making the bad decision in decision making process. Forex contracts involve the right to buy or sell a certain amount of a foreign currency at a fixed price in U. S. dollars. Profits or losses accrue as the exchange rate of that currency fluctuates on the open market. It is extremely rare that individual traders actually see the foreign currency. Instead, they typically close out their buy or sell commitments and calculate net gains or losses based on price changes in that currency relative to the dollar over time. Forex markets are among the most active markets in the world in terms of dollar volume. The participants include large banks, multinational corporations, governments, and speculators. Individual traders comprise a very small part of this market. Because of the volatility in the price of foreign currency, losses can accrue very rapidly, wiping out an investors down payment in short order. Any company operating globally must deal in foreign currencies. It has to pay suppliers in other countries with a currency different from its home countrys currency. The home country is where a company is headquartered. The firm is likely to be paid or have profits in a different currency and will want to exchange it for its home currency. Even if a company expects to be paid in its own currency, it must assess the risk that the buyer may not be able to pay the full amount due to currency fluctuations. XE Currency Converter Live Rates. In physics, the fundamental interactions, also known as fundamental forces, are the interactions that do not appear to be reducible to more basic interactions. There are four conventionally accepted fundamental interactionsgravitational, electromagnetic, strong nuclear, and weak nuclear. Each one is described mathematically as a field. The gravitational force is modelled as a continuous classical field. The other three, part of the Standard Model of particle physics, are described as discrete quantum fields, and their interactions are each carried by a quantum, an elementary particle. The exchange of bosons always carries energy and momentum between the fermions, thereby changing their speed and direction. The exchange may also transport a charge between the fermions, changing the charges of the fermions in the process e. Since bosons carry one unit of angular momentum, the fermions spin direction will flip from Plancks constant. Because an interaction results in fermions attracting and repelling each other, an older term for interaction is force. According to the present understanding, there are four fundamental interactions or forces gravitation, electromagnetism, the weak interaction, and the strong interaction. Their magnitude and behaviour vary greatly, as described in the table below. Modern physics attempts to explain every observed physical phenomenon by these fundamental interactions. Moreover, reducing the number of different interaction types is seen as desirable. Two cases in point are the unification of. Electric and magnetic force into electromagnetism. The electromagnetic interaction and the weak interaction into the electroweak interaction see below.
